I had a DG pipe, k&n filter, jet kit, web cam, stock gearing and it would do a honest 60 mph (GPS) on my lakota. I think that was the best bang for the money. I never checked the speed before the mods but i believe 52 mph. Still have no clue as to whether it has a rev limiter or not.
